Course Summary

Course Category: PLC (Further Education - FET) - Apply directly to College

This course allows students to develop their core knowledge of fashion to a more advanced level. It aims at developing creative and technical skills focused on gaining employment in the fashion industry and also allowing the student the opportunity to present a strong portfolio in fashion. Project work includes a wide range of activities including design, illustration, trend forecasting, styling, pattern cutting, garment construction, retailing and fashion photography. Students are encouraged to enter various fashion competitions and visit regular exhibitions and shows with a view to presenting their work for exhibition at the end of the school year with the college. The aim of the course is to give students skills which will have a strong grounding in the fashion industry.

QQI Fashion Design – Level 6 (6M3706).

What will you study?

    Communications - 6N1950
    Computer Illustrated Graphics - 5N1929
    Fabric Manipulation - 6N3606
    Fashion Buying & Retailing - 6N3612
    Garment Construction - 6N3605
    Illustration Techniques & Practice - 6N3480
    Pattern Drafting - 6N1393
    Design Skills - 6N3446
    Work Experience - 6N1946

The Student - Career Interests

This course is typically suited for people with the following Career Interests:

Creative

Creative people are drawn to careers and activities that enable them to take responsibility for the design, layout or sensory impact of something (visual, auditory etc). They may be atrracted to the traditional artistic pursuits such as painting, sculpture, singing, the performing arts or music. Or they may show more interest in design activities, such as architecture, animation, or craft areas, such as pottery and ceramics.

Creative people use their personal understanding of people and the world they live in to guide their work. Creative people like to work in unstructured workplaces, enjoy taking risks and prefer a minimum of routine.
